What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Denver to Hartford?

The average price of all flights from Denver to Hartford cl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.
When flying from Denver to Hartford, you should consider leaving on a Thursday and avoid Sundays if you are looking for the best rates. For your return to Denver, you’ll find the best rates on Saturdays and the most expensive ones on Mondays.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Denver to Hartford?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for flights from Denver to Hartford,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.
The cheapest month for flights from Denver to Hartford is October, where tickets cost $426 on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are June and November, where the average cost of tickets is $546 and $542 respectively.

Which airlines fly non-stop between Denver and Hartford?

Airline and price data is aggregated from results in KAYAK’s search results from the last 2 weeks for flights from Denver to Hartford.
There are 2 airlines that fly nonstop from Denver to Hartford. They are Southwest and United Airlines. The cheapest airline for this route is United Airlines, with the best one-way deal found costing $324. On average, the best prices for this route can be found at United Airlines.

How many flights are there between Denver and Hartford per day?

Each day, there are between 3 and 5 nonstop flights that take off from Denver and land in Hartford, with an average flight time of 3h 45m. The most common departure time is 10:00 am and most flights take off in the morning. Each week, there are 26 flights. The most frequent day of departure is Thursday, when 19% of all weekly flights depart. The fewest flights depart on a Tuesday.

How long does a flight from Denver to Hartford take?

Nonstop flights from Denver generally make it to Hartford in 3h 41m. The flying distance between the two cities is 1,666 miles.

  • What is the best means of transport to the city center from BDL airport?

    If you don't have a vehicle, using the line 30 bus into downtown Hartford is the most efficient and cost-effective method to get from Hartford Airport (BDL) to the city center. The trip takes around 22 minutes and costs between $1 and $4.

  • Which facilities are available at the car rental center in Hartford Bradley International Airport?

    The automobile rental facility at Hartford Bradley International Airport is equipped to provide a quick and easy pick-up and drop-off experience for customers. Free transportation to and from the airport is offered via shuttles operating between the facility and the airport. Passengers with limited mobility may easily navigate the facilities using a wheelchair. Restrooms, a waiting area, and a parking lot are all provided for your convenience. At the location where you hire a vehicle, there are disabled passenger facilities as well as a specific parking lot set aside for travelers with disabilities.

  • Are there hotels at DEN airport?

    The Westin Denver International Airport is a 4-star hotel that is well-liked for its two bars and fitness facility that is open around the clock. It is situated about 0.1 miles away from Denver International Airport (DEN). Also in close proximity to the airport is the Gaylord Rockies Resort & Convention Center, which can be reached by car in 4.7 miles.

  • Are there parking services at DEN airport?

    The cost of valet parking in either the east or west garage is around $35 for the whole day. Your options for long-term parking at Denver International Airport will be the Economy Lots, the Pikes Peak Lot, and the Mt. Elbert Lot.

  • Concourse B west (near gate B32) is where you'll find the United Club lounges while you're flying out of Denver International Airport. The club opens every day at 5:00 am and closes at 9:00 pm. The Concourse B east lounge (near gate B44) is open for business every day beginning at 05:30 am and ending at 11:30 pm.
  • The Denver International Airport (DEN) has three breastfeeding rooms for parents who are traveling with their infants and need a place to nurse in privacy and comfort. Conveniently situated in the middle of concourses A, B, and C, these areas offer quiet, clean spaces for parents.
  • After passing through security, the pet relief rooms may be found in the center cores of gates A, B, and C. On the western side of the Jeppesen Terminal right outside door 200, there is a pre-security outdoor pet relief area. Every pet relief area satisfies the requirements of the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A).
  • Within the concourse of terminal A of Bradley International Airport (BDL), there are a total of four automated teller machines. Once you have passed through TSA there are four ATMs positioned in the direction of gates 1-12 and there is one ATMs located in the direction of gates 20-30. The New England Travel Mart can be found right next to the ATM that is around gates 20-30.
  • At BDL Airport, the Skycap service is available on the upper level to help passengers with their bags. In addition, they provide curbside check-in and provide wheelchair assistance for passengers to and from the doors of the aircraft.
